The Mukhtasar follows the traditional structure of a fiqh manual, systematically organizing its contents into thematic books ( kutub ). While the author's original manuscript has not survived, his arrangement generally begins with the foundational pillars of Islamic practice—purity ( tahara ), prayer ( salat ), and fasting ( sawm )—before proceeding to the laws governing personal status, commercial transactions, and criminal penalties. For students, scholars, and practitioners of the , few texts hold the same authority and significance as Mukhtasar Khalil (Mukhtasar al-Khalil). Authored by the 14th-century Egyptian scholar Shaykh Khalil ibn Ishaq al-Jundi (d. 776 AH), this monumental work serves as the definitive reference for legal rulings within the Maliki madhhab.
